Mr. & Mrs. B. W. Collier - Deaths in Family

Mr. And Mrs. B. W. Collier have the sympathy of all in this time of double affliction.  Hardly had the clods ceased to ring from falling over the grave of their daughter, Mrs. Cleveland, ere the news came of the death of their son's wife, Mrs. B. A. Collier.  She died in New York City, where she had gone to be treated for cancer.  She died under a surgical operation.  We truly sympathize with the old parents, and Bryan who was our comrade in arms and all members of the family

Middle Ga. Argus - Week of October 27, 1891
